Structural Integrity and Thermal Management: the inspiration of Longevity
The physical development of an LED fixture would be the bedrock on which its lifespan is crafted. Heat is the main adversary of LED overall performance and longevity. excessive warmth accelerates the degradation of the LED chip as well as other electronic parts, bringing about premature failure and diminished gentle output. thus, optimizing the item composition for productive heat dissipation is paramount for extending provider existence and, Therefore, delivering environmental Positive aspects.
superior-quality products Engage in an important function. making use of quality-grade aluminum for that luminaire housing, for instance, gives excellent thermal conductivity when compared to more cost-effective alloys or plastics. Aluminum functions as a successful warmth sink, drawing thermal Vitality far from the delicate LED modules and dissipating it in the bordering natural environment. Complementing this, sturdy polycarbonate (Laptop) diffusers don't just assure even gentle distribution but will also have large thermal resistance, avoiding warmth buildup close to The sunshine supply and sustaining structural integrity over time.
past elements, complex thermal administration process design and style is critical. This entails engineering inner pathways for airflow, optimizing the placement and geometry of warmth sinks, and guaranteeing a secure thermal connection among the LED board and the heat-dissipating components. By effectively running running temperatures and avoiding overheating, manufacturers can appreciably slow down the getting old technique of the LEDs and linked electronics.
The environmental payoff is direct: enhanced thermal efficiency interprets right into a lower failure level. A fixture made to previous for a longer period inherently minimizes the frequency of replacements. This means much less assets are consumed in production new units, much less Electricity is expended from the generation approach, and the need for raw components is lessened. lowering failures at the resource is usually a basic move in minimizing the environmental impact related to lights infrastructure.
The Heart on the issue: High-Longevity LED Main know-how
though the framework provides the mandatory guidance process, the standard of the LED chip by itself is central to attaining legitimate very long-lifestyle effectiveness. The core gentle supply dictates not merely the First performance but additionally how nicely the fixture maintains its brightness and steadiness more than 1000s of hours of operation.
deciding on significant-efficacy chips from highly regarded brands can be a significant design and style decision. These top quality LEDs are engineered for slower lumen depreciation – the gradual reduce in light-weight output after a while. Inferior chips may perhaps expertise speedy brightness decay, that means the fixture consumes practically the identical degree of Vitality but produces significantly considerably less mild. This represents a concealed sort of energy squander. A fixture Geared up with high-longevity chips maintains its helpful mild output for for much longer, making sure that the Power consumed carries on to translate into successful illumination.
Also, significant-excellent chips exhibit better stability and dependability. They may be fewer prone to color shifts or sudden failures. This Increased steadiness straight impacts upkeep cycles. Fixtures that consistently carry out as expected require less Recurrent servicing and intervention. For large installations, this interprets into important environmental financial savings by minimizing the need for routine maintenance crews, services automobiles, and substitute elements, all of that have their very own carbon footprints. By buying a remarkable LED core, producers ensure the luminaire provides sustained functionality, minimizing both equally Vitality waste because of inefficiency as well as the environmental stress of Repeated upkeep.
Taming the availability Chain: Reducing Logistics and Packaging Impacts
The environmental effect of a product extends significantly further than its operational phase. your entire provide chain, from Uncooked material extraction to last shipping and eventual disposal, contributes to its overall footprint. Extending the lifespan of the LED fixture provides significant, even though usually overlooked, benefits in mitigating these upstream and downstream impacts, notably relating to logistics and packaging.
an extended-lasting gentle fixture inherently usually means less alternative cycles over a given period. look at a business Place or a sizable household challenge: doubling the lifespan of your set up lighting cuts the number of upcoming replacement purchases, and Therefore the involved transportation wants, by half. This directly lessens the fuel use and carbon emissions linked to shipping concluded merchandise through the producer to distributors, shops, and conclude-consumers. much less shipments also signify fewer congestion and don on transportation infrastructure.
The reduction in replacement frequency cascades into packaging cost savings. anytime a fixture is transported, it requires protective packaging – typically cardboard containers, foam inserts, plastic wrapping, and tape. By extending the product's lifestyle, the whole volume of those packaging components consumed over the lifespan of the set up decreases proportionally. This lessens the need for virgin resources (like timber for cardboard or petroleum for plastics), reduces the energy Employed in packaging production, and finally decreases the level of packaging squander that should be managed, recycled, or probably despatched to landfill. minimizing the sheer variety of units flowing throughout the offer chain because of prolonged product existence is a robust way to lessen its All round environmental burden.
Stemming the Tide of E-Waste: a far more Rhythmic Approach to Recycling
Electronic waste, or e-waste, has become the fastest-rising squander streams globally, posing important environmental troubles on account of the possibly hazardous elements contained inside of electronic parts. LED fixtures, containing circuit boards, motorists, and semiconductor chips, lead to this stream on disposal. building for longevity is an important system for mitigating the e-squander challenge affiliated with lights.
When LED fixtures have a short lifespan, they add to the quick cycle of obsolescence and disposal. This can result in surges in e-waste, overpowering current recycling infrastructure and escalating the risk of incorrect disposal, where by hazardous substances can leach into soil and h2o. By appreciably extending the operational life of LED luminaires, companies efficiently decelerate this substitution cycle.
A longer merchandise lifestyle implies that fixtures continue to be in company For several a lot more yrs, delaying their entry in to the squander stream. This results in a far more manageable, rhythmic stream of finish-of-lifetime merchandise, making it possible for recycling services and waste management methods to handle the quantity a lot more properly. It also lowers the force on corporations and consumers to consistently control the disposal and opportunity recycling fees linked to Regular replacements. Delaying the creation of waste is usually a elementary basic principle of environmental stewardship, and extensive-life layout achieves specifically this, obtaining important time for the development of far more efficient and thorough recycling methods and lessening the fast burden on landfill potential.
Operational performance and environmentally friendly constructing Synergies
For large-scale lighting jobs – like industrial facilities, warehouses, parking garages, workshops, or in depth customized garage lights installations – the operational and servicing (O&M) implications of fixture lifespan are considerable. Long-daily life style features significant advantages in lessening O&M expenditures, which frequently have their own personal environmental footprint, and contributes positively to reaching sustainable setting up certifications.
In large installations, changing unsuccessful luminaires just isn't a trivial activity. It often requires specialized devices like scissor lifts or increase lifts, specifically for prime ceilings, consuming Power and demanding qualified labor. Frequent replacements translate into recurring maintenance schedules, enhanced labor several hours, and potential operational disruptions. An LED process created for longevity greatly lessens the frequency of these interventions. This not just saves immediate charges but also minimizes the environmental effects linked to upkeep pursuits – fewer fuel burned by service vehicles, minimized require for Electricity-intensive access equipment, and fewer squander generated from changed elements.
Furthermore, the press to sustainable developing procedures has led for the widespread adoption of eco-friendly setting up rating devices like LEED (Leadership in Power and Environmental layout) and perfectly. These frameworks frequently award points for techniques that boost making functionality and lower environmental impact about the setting up's lifecycle. Specifying extended-lifestyle lighting fixtures can contribute to reaching credits linked to supplies and sources (e.g., squander reduction) and operational effectiveness. sturdy, reduced-routine maintenance lighting units align perfectly Along with the aims of creating properties that aren't only Electrical power-successful but in addition source-effective and sustainable to operate in excess of the long run.
